- Reference (shelfmark):
- Add MS 88869
- Title:
- Scope & Content:
-
1. ff. 1-103. Autograph draft in pencil by Burton, inscribed by him on the outer wrapper, 'Bayrut' and on the inner wrapper, 'Hebron (El Kahlil) and the Cave Tombs of the Patriarchs'. Folios have numeration by Burton; insertions include (pasted on the verso of 55 [f. 58v]) a plan, with key, of the mosque at Hebron, by Burton and Charles Tyrwhitt Drake, dated 1871, and additions to the text on different sizes of paper, including a printed leaf with autograph additions. Apparently unpublished, though some annotations in ink in the earlier part suggest marking up for the press.
2. ff. 104-118. Miscellaneous autograph notes and drafts on various sizes of paper and subjects, including Syria (with a reference to Charles Tyrwhitt Drake, and Africa).
3. ff. 119-159. Autograph draft, entitled by Burton on the wrapper, 'Appendix 5/Affair at Nazareth', containing a detailed account of the period, 4 May- 5 Aug. 1871, when the Burtons and Tyrwhitt Drake were camped near Nazareth. Stitched in paper wrappers.
